EPA's Solar Grant Cancellation Sparks Sector-Wide Jitters
The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ency’s termination of the Biden-Harris Administration’s $7-billion Solar for All grant program has sent shockwaves through the renewable energy sector. This initiative, designed to subsidize residential solar in low-income communities, represented a critical tailwind for downstream manufacturers like TPI Composites. The abrupt policy reversal, announced on August 8, 2025, has triggered a liquidity crunch in the solar value chain. While TPI Composites is not a direct beneficiary of the program, the broader market is interpreting the move as a signal of regulatory instability, particularly in the wake of the Trump administration’s recent offshore wind pauses. The stock’s collapse reflects a flight to safety as investors recalibrate expectations for near-term demand and capital allocation in the sector.
